MySQL 添加表的数据库操作步骤
以下是在 MySQL 数据库中添加表的详细步骤:
1. 连接到 MySQL 数据库
您需要连接到 MySQL 数据库,以下是一个使用 MySQL 命令行工具连接到数据库的示例:
mysql u [username] p[password] [database_name]
其中[username]
是您的 MySQL 用户名,[password]
是对应的密码,[database_name]
是您想要连接的数据库名称。
2. 创建新表
在成功连接到数据库后,您可以使用以下 SQL 语句来创建一个新的表:
CREATE TABLE [table_name] ( [column1_name] [data_type] [column_specific_characteristics], [column2_name] [data_type] [column_specific_characteristics], ... [columnN_name] [data_type] [column_specific_characteristics] );
[table_name]
是您想要创建的表的名称。
[column1_name]
至[columnN_name]
是表中的列名。
[data_type]
是列的数据类型,例如INT
,VARCHAR
,DATE
等。
[column_specific_characteristics]
是列的特定属性,例如NOT NULL
,AUTO_INCREMENT
,PRIMARY KEY
等。
3. 示例:创建一个简单的用户表
以下是一个创建用户表的示例:
CREATE TABLE users ( id INT AUTO_INCREMENT PRIMARY KEY, username VARCHAR(50) NOT NULL, email VARCHAR(100) NOT NULL UNIQUE, password VARCHAR(255) NOT NULL, created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P );
在这个例子中,我们创建了一个名为users
的表,其中包含以下列:
id
: 一个自动增长的整数,作为主键。
username
: 一个字符串,用于存储用户的用户名。
email
: 一个字符串,用于存储用户的电子邮件地址,且唯一。
password
: 一个字符串,用于存储用户的密码。
created_at
: 一个时间戳,用于记录用户创建的时间。
4. 查询新表
创建表后,您可以使用DESCRIBE
语句来查看表的结构:
DESCRIBE [table_name];
5. 退出 MySQL
完成操作后,您可以使用以下命令退出 MySQL:
EXIT;
或者:
QUIT;
就是在 MySQL 数据库中添加表的详细步骤和示例,请根据您的具体需求调整表结构和数据类型。